Kuwait Model
Kuwait is practicing self regulationof Islamic financial
institutions
There is no Shariah Advisory Councilat the Central Bank of
Kuwait
Section 10, Chapter 3, Central Bank of Kuwait Law
32/1968provides that every Islamic financial institution shall
have its own Shariah Supervisory Board
